The 5 Stages of Spend Management

The 5 Stages of Spend Management

When it comes to effective spend management, there are five key stages that businesses should follow. These stages help ensure that costs are controlled and resources are optimized throughout the procurement process.

1. Planning: The first stage involves setting clear objectives and developing a comprehensive plan for managing spend. This includes identifying the categories of goods and services that need to be procured, as well as establishing budgetary constraints and performance metrics.

2. Sourcing: Once the planning stage is complete, businesses can move on to sourcing suppliers or vendors who can provide the required goods or services at competitive prices. This involves evaluating potential suppliers based on factors such as quality, reliability, and cost-effectiveness.

3. Contracting: After selecting suitable suppliers, it’s essential to negotiate favorable contracts that outline pricing terms, delivery schedules, quality standards, and other relevant details. Effective contract management helps minimize risks and ensures compliance with legal requirements.

4. Procurement: With contracts in place, businesses can proceed with procuring the desired goods or services while adhering to predetermined budgets and timelines. Efficient procurement processes streamline purchasing activities through centralized systems or automated tools.

5. Performance Monitoring: The final stage involves ongoing monitoring of supplier performance against established metrics such as cost savings achieved, delivery accuracy, product/service quality levels, and customer satisfaction ratings. Regular evaluation helps identify areas for improvement while maintaining accountability among suppliers.

By following these five stages of spend management diligently companies can maximize their cost control efforts resulting in increased efficiency throughout their procurement operations without compromising on quality or service delivery.

How to Implement Spend Management in Your Business

Implementing spend management in your business is a vital step towards maximizing cost control and optimizing procurement processes. To effectively implement spend management, you need to follow these key strategies.

1. Analyze and categorize spending: Start by analyzing your current spending patterns and categorizing them into different areas such as direct costs, indirect costs, and overhead expenses. This will help you gain visibility into where your money is going and identify areas for potential savings.

2. Set realistic goals: Once you have identified the areas for improvement, set specific and measurable goals that align with your overall business objectives. For example, aim to reduce non-essential spending by a certain percentage or negotiate better terms with suppliers to minimize costs.

3. Develop clear policies: Establish clear policies and procedures around purchasing decisions, including guidelines for approving purchases, preferred vendors, contract negotiation tactics, and budget allocation methods. Communicate these policies effectively to all employees involved in the procurement process.

4. Use technology tools: Leverage spend management software or other technological solutions that can streamline the procurement process and provide real-time data on spending trends. These tools can help automate tasks like purchase order creation, invoice processing, vendor selection, and performance tracking.

5. Monitor progress regularly: Continuously monitor your progress towards achieving your spend management goals through regular reporting and analysis of key metrics like savings achieved or compliance with established policies. Adjust your strategies as needed based on the insights gained from this monitoring process.

By implementing these strategies consistently across your organization, you can drive significant improvements in cost control while ensuring that essential goods and services are obtained efficiently at competitive prices.

Spend Management Tools and Resources

Spend Management Tools and Resources

When it comes to implementing effective spend management strategies, having the right tools and resources at your disposal is crucial. These tools can help streamline your procurement processes, maximize cost control, and ultimately drive greater savings for your business.

One essential tool for spend management is a robust procurement software platform. This technology enables you to automate key procurement tasks such as vendor selection, purchase order creation, and invoice processing. With real-time visibility into spending data, you can identify areas of potential savings and negotiate better deals with suppliers.

Additionally, analytics tools play a vital role in spend management by providing actionable insights into your spending patterns. By analyzing historical data and trends, these tools can highlight opportunities for cost reduction or optimization in various expense categories.

Another valuable resource for effective spend management is access to market intelligence. Staying informed about market conditions, supplier performance metrics, and industry benchmarks allows you to make more informed decisions regarding vendor selection and contract negotiations.

Collaboration platforms also play an important role in efficient spend management. These tools facilitate communication between different stakeholders involved in the procurement process – from requisitioners to approvers – ensuring clear visibility on budget limits and improving overall efficiency.

In addition to technology-driven solutions, leveraging external expertise through consulting services or engaging with industry associations can provide valuable insights into best practices for optimizing spend management processes within your specific industry.

By utilizing these tools and resources effectively as part of your overall spend management strategy, you can enhance cost control efforts while driving sustainable long-term savings for your business.
